West Australian quick Bryce Jackson has secured a one-year contract extension with the Perth Scorchers, following the departure of Jason Behrendorff to the Melbourne Renegades, positioning him for a potential debut. Jackson, who excelled in one-day cricket last summer, expressed excitement about continuing with the Scorchers and emphasized the valuable lessons learned from his first year on the team.

‘Fireball’ shoots across WA’s night sky in what the Perth Observatory believes to be space junk
A bright fireball illuminated the night sky over Western Australia on Friday, prompting numerous reports to the Perth Observatory from excited spectators. The observatory humorously noted that the spectacle was likely space junk rather than extraterrestrial beings, as locals shared their awe-inspiring experiences of the event across the state.
